An inventory management system is a software-based solution that helps businesses keep track of their goods, supplies, and raw materials. It allows companies to monitor and control their inventory levels efficiently, ensuring that they always have the right amount of stock on hand to meet customer demand. One of the primary benefits of an inventory management system is improved accuracy. Manual inventory tracking methods, such as spreadsheets or pen and paper, are prone to errors and can lead to costly mistakes. With an automated system in place, you can eliminate these inaccuracies and ensure that your inventory data is always up to date. This not only helps prevent stockouts and overstock situations but also improves the overall efficiency of your operations. By having real-time access to accurate inventory information, you can make more informed decisions about purchasing, pricing, and order fulfillment.

Another advantage of using an inventory management system is increased productivity. By automating mundane tasks such as inventory counting and reconciliation, you can free up your employees’ time to focus on more valuable activities. This can lead to higher efficiency in your warehouse operations, faster order processing times, and ultimately, happier customers. Additionally, with advanced features like barcode scanning and RFID technology, you can streamline your inventory processes further, reducing the risk of human error and expediting the fulfillment process.

Cost savings are also a significant benefit of implementing an inventory management system. By having better control over your inventory levels and ordering practices, you can minimize carrying costs and avoid unnecessary stock purchases. Additionally, having real-time visibility into your inventory data can help you identify trends and forecast demand more accurately, enabling you to optimize your inventory levels and reduce the risk of overstocking or stockouts. This can result in reduced storage costs, lower holding costs, and ultimately, increased profitability for your business.

Moreover, an inventory management system can help improve customer satisfaction. By ensuring that you always have the right products in stock when customers need them, you can reduce the likelihood of delays or backorders. This can lead to higher customer loyalty, repeat business, and positive word-of-mouth referrals. Additionally, with features like automated order notifications and tracking, you can keep your customers informed every step of the way, providing a seamless and satisfying shopping experience.

In today’s competitive marketplace, having real-time visibility into your inventory data is crucial for staying ahead of the curve. An inventory management system provides you with actionable insights and analytics that can help you make strategic decisions about your inventory, suppliers, and distribution channels. Whether it’s identifying slow-moving items, optimizing reorder points, or segmenting your customer base, the data generated by your inventory management system can help you uncover hidden opportunities for growth and improvement.

Furthermore, an inventory management system can help you ensure regulatory compliance and traceability. With features like lot tracking, expiration date management, and recall management, you can easily track and trace your products throughout the supply chain, ensuring that you meet industry standards and regulations. This can be especially important for industries with strict quality control requirements, such as pharmaceuticals or food and beverage. By having robust traceability capabilities in place, you can quickly identify and address any issues that arise, minimizing the impact on your customers and brand reputation.
